Your fitbit adjustment is the number of calories your fitbit says your burned all day (including any exercise you tracked on it) minus whatever calories mfp thinks you burned (including any exercise you logged on mfp).
If you recorded the spin class on your fitbit, it’s already accounted for and you’ll get the calorie credit for it. It will not show up in your diary as a specific workout though.
If you log the spin class on mfp, that amount will overwrite what fitbit recorded for that time period. So logging it on mfp will just replace the fitbit entry that already exists.
As long as you record exercise on your fitbit, then you don’t need to log it on mfp.
If you don’t record exercise on your fitbit (like if you have the One model), then you’ll want to log non-step based exercise on mfp.2
